Output e62f30c5da058c57b275c6c4b4bf3aa518d961d1c90833e164e0e3ecafd08801:12

value
103683
script pubkey
OP_0 OP_PUSHBYTES_20 53a8e998f12f65e7f4a8dd722d5c6856665afc4a
address
bc1q2w5wnx839aj70a9gm4ez6hrg2en94lz2h4d4em
transaction
e62f30c5da058c57b275c6c4b4bf3aa518d961d1c90833e164e0e3ecafd08801